constexpr: the result of a relational operator between pointers to void is
unspecified unless the pointers are equal; therefore, such a comparison is not
a constant expression unless the pointers are equal.

+      // C++11 [expr.rel]p3:
+      //   Pointers to void (after pointer conversions) can be compared, with a
+      //   result defined as follows: If both pointers represent the same
+      //   address or are both the null pointer value, the result is true if the
+      //   operator is <= or >= and false otherwise; otherwise the result is
+      //   unspecified.
+      // We interpret this as applying to pointers to *cv* void.
+      if (LHSTy->isVoidPointerType() && LHSOffset != RHSOffset &&
+          E->getOpcode() != BO_EQ && E->getOpcode() != BO_NE)
+        CCEDiag(E, diag::note_constexpr_void_comparison);
